Job Summary:
As an SMSF Accountant, you will be responsible for managing a portfolio of self-managed superannuation funds (SMSFs) and providing expert advice to clients on tax, superannuation, and compliance matters. Your primary role will involve ensuring that all SMSFs under your responsibility are fully compliant with relevant legislation and regulations. This includes preparing financial statements, tax returns, and other compliance documents for the SMSFs. You will be responsible for ensuring that all work is completed accurately and within established timeframes.
In addition to managing the SMSF portfolio, you will be expected to provide expert advice on superannuation, tax, and compliance matters to clients. This will require you to keep up-to-date with changes in superannuation and tax legislation to ensure that your clients are always provided with the most accurate and relevant advice.
As an SMSF Accountant, you will also be required to liaise with clients and external stakeholders, including auditors and the ATO. Your strong communication and interpersonal skills will be essential in effectively communicating complex tax and superannuation matters to clients and stakeholders.
Overall, the SMSF Accountant role is highly specialized and requires a strong understanding of superannuation and tax legislation, as well as excellent technical skills and attention to detail. You will be expected to manage a portfolio of clients and meet deadlines while providing expert advice and excellent customer service.
